Successfully reported this slideshow.
We use your LinkedIn profile and activity data to personalize ads and to show you more relevant ads. You can change your ad preferences anytime.

Couchbase Analytics Overview – Connect Silicon Valley 2018

47 views

Published on

Speaker: Sachin Smotra, Director of Product Management, Couchbase

Due to the lack of built-in analytics, many NoSQL database customers export data from their operational databases into analytical platforms that are installed and managed separately. This approach is complex to manage, costly to operate, and makes application queries across both repositories difficult and error prone. But most importantly, it creates barriers to getting real-time operational analytics. The Couchbase Server Analytics service adds analytical capabilities to Couchbase Server, enabling real-time and ad hoc analytics over operational data, all within the same Couchbase cluster.

The Couchbase Analytics service is one of the newer members of the Couchbase Data Platform family of services. This session will provide an overview of this service, which delivers parallel evaluation of analytical queries on current data with minimal impact on the operational performance of the Couchbase cluster. We will examine the architecture of the new service, describe its SQL++ based query interface, and share the roadmap for this important new capability.

Published in: Technology
  • Be the first to comment

  • Be the first to like this

Couchbase Analytics Overview – Connect Silicon Valley 2018

  1. 1.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. Couchbase Analytics Bringing NoETL to NoSQL Sachin Smotra, Director Product Management
  2. 2.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. Why Analytics?
  3. 3.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. 3 ENGAGEMENT DATABASE 14 TRANSACTIONAL DATABASE ANALYTICAL DATABASE
  4. 4.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. Value Proposition
  5. 5.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. 6 Traditional Analytics Solutions Analytics Tool Business Application Operations Data Batch Batch Ops DBOps DB Ops DB ETL Analytical DB
  6. 6.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. 7 Couchbase Analytics – Bringing NoETL to NoSQL Analytics Tool Business Application Ops Data Node Analytics Node Couchbase Data Platform
  7. 7.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. 8 Couchbase Analytics enables organizations to derive rich real-time insights on operational data.
  8. 8.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. 9 What is Couchbase Analytics? Fast Ingest Real-time Insights for Business Teams Complex Queries on Large Datasets =+ ANALYTICS ANALYTICS ANALYTICS ANALYTICS DATA DATA DATA Shadow Dataset of a Couchbase Data node MPP architecture: parallelization among core and servers
  9. 9.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. 10 Evolution of Couchbase Analytics Developer Preview 4 Integrated Statistics RBAC Developer Preview 5 Unified installer Fully-integrated with data platform 6.0 Beta Streamlined DDL Complete function library Performance optimizations Developer Preview 1 MPP Engine for Analytics Workload isolation Fast ingest for JSON data Developer Preview 2 Configurable parallelism SDK support Developer Preview 3 Integrated cluster management Cluster scaling Analytics workbench Nov 2016 Apr 2017 Oct 2017 Dec 2017 Mar 2018 Aug 2018
  10. 10.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. 11 Fast Ingest Operational data is available for analytical processing in near real-time by creating a shadow dataset using the highly optimized Couchbase Database Change Protocol. Real-time insights MPP query engine can run ad-hoc queries to perform complex joins, groupings, aggregations and count. No impact on operational workflows due to workload isolation. NoETL for NoSQL No separate infrastructure or programming required to manage analytical workloads. Reduced Complexity Simplified operations and manageability with a single platform for running operational and analytical workloads. Developer Productivity Leverage existing skills - SQL-like queries to analyze data. Secure Access Access Control to analytical datasets can be managed independently. Enterprise Ready HA, scale, zero downtime upgrade are key tenets of the Couchbase platform. Key Benefits
  11. 11.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. Query and Analytics
  12. 12.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. 13 QUERY SERVICE • Online search and booking, reviews and ratings • Property and room detail pages • Cross-sell links, up-sell links • Stars & likes & associated reviews • Their booking history N1QL queries behind every page display and click/navigation ANALYTICS SERVICE • Reporting, Trend Analysis, Data Exploration • Daily discount availability report • Cities with highest room occupancy rates • Hotels with biggest single day drops • How many searches turn into bookings grouped by property rating? grouped by family size? Business Analysts ask these questions without knowing in advance every aspect of the question Query and Analytics Services
  13. 13.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. Partnerships
  14. 14.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. 15 Partner Ecosystem Native JSON Visualization ● Ability to build Native NoSQL visualizations ODBC / JDBC ● Enables integration with tools like Tableau, Excel, Power BI ● Driver available at www.cdata.com/drivers/couchbase Machine Learning ● Most popular notebook for Data Science ● Integration via the python SDK ● Spark Connector for Couchbase data platform is available
  15. 15.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. Pricing
  16. 16.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. 17 Licensing Couchbase services are monetized through adding additional nodes which 1) encourages platform adoption 2) simplifies buying & selling and 3) enables dynamic environments Data Service Data Service Analytics Service Index Service Query Service FTS Service Same Subscription per CB Instance Regardless of Service Type
  17. 17. Confidential and Proprietary. Do not distribute without Couchbase consent. © Couchbase 2018. All rights reserved. THANK YOU

×